Grammy-winning rockers Evanescence dropped a surprise video on New Year’s Eve to rock into 2024.

“Yeah Right” was shot during the band’s tour of Latin America last year and was directed and edited by Eric Richter. The song comes from 2021’s The Bitter Truth while the video’s flashes of black and blue recall the color scheme of the band’s 2003 breakthrough, Fallen.

In November, Evanescence celebrated 20 years of Fallen with remastered versions of the album across multiple formats with previously unseen photos from the era, a handwritten foreword, and a rare selection of B-sides and recordings.

A Deluxe Box Set, including a cassette of 10 previously unreleased demos and voice notes, a book featuring new track-by-track notes, a custom turntable slipmat, plus a set of rare photo prints and an enamel pin set is slated for release next month.
